Worcester Foregate Street station is well-equipped to cater to the needs of every traveler. The ticket office is open from 6:10 AM to 7: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, while the doors open slightly later on Sundays, from 9:00 AM to 4:45 PM. Ticket machines are available for those who prefer a quick, self-service option, and these are accessible for all passengers. Whether you bought your tickets online or are purchasing them on the spot, you'll find the process straightforward.
The station ensures accessibility is prioritized, featuring step-free access to all platforms, making life easier for those with reduced mobility. Assistance can be arranged for passengers needing additional support, and help is readily available during operating hours. Waiting rooms, accessible toilets, and seating areas make waiting for your train comfortable and stress-free.
Safety is also a top concern at the station, with CCTV coverage to provide peace of mind for all travelers. Additionally, while the station doesn't offer luggage storage, it does have a secure and supportive environment for visitors.

Earlswood (Surrey) Train Station ensures a smooth ticketing experience with its convenient ticket office, operational weekdays from 06:30 to 10:45, and ticket machines available 24/7 for all your travel needs. It's reassuring to know that tickets bought online can be easily collected here. The station proudly accommodates passengers requiring accessibility features, boasting disabled-friendly ticket machines and induction loops for hearing aid users. However, note that step-free access is only available to platform 1.
The station is equipped with helplines and customer service points, providing real-time information and assistance to travelers. There is also CCTV surveillance ensuring a secure environment. While the station lacks a waiting room and first-class lounges, it provides a seating area for comfort before your journey. Refreshment facilities are on hand to make waiting times more enjoyable, although there are no ATMs or shopping outlets available currently.
Getting to and from Earlswood (Surrey) Station is seamless with multiple transport links. There are options for buses and a rail replacement service should you need them, providing flexibility for urban or countryside explorations. The station’s car park, managed by APCOA Parking UK, offers free parking with 22 spaces, including one accessible bay. While there are no accessible taxis directly available, ample space in front of the station provides ease for drop-off and pick-up points. Bicycle enthusiasts will appreciate the sheltered cycle stands adjacent to Platform 1.
